概括
研究人员发现了拼接因子SF3B1如何通过SUGP1招募DHX15RNA螺旋酶,澄清了内部去除精度和与癌症相关的拼接部位激活.

背景情况:
- 从前mRNA中精确地去除内子是至关重要的,并且涉及RNA螺旋酶.
- 这些螺旋酶的招募机制到spliceosome/pre-mRNA复合体并未得到充分理解.
研究的目的:
- 阐明SF3B1与SUGP1相互作用以招募DHX15RNA酶的分子机制.
- 开发一个模型,解释这种相互作用如何影响拼接精度和异常拼接部位激活.
主要方法:
- 生物化学实验 生物化学实验
- 基于人工智能的结构预测预测.
- 蛋白质与蛋白质相互作用建模.
主要成果:
- 为SF3B1,SUGP1和DHX15之间的相互作用生成了一个模型.
- SF3B1相互作用暴露了SUGP1的G补丁域,使DHX15结合和激活.
- 该模型解释了与癌症中的SF3B1/SUGP1突变相关的神秘3'拼接部位激活.
结论:
- 该研究提供了RNA酶在拼接中的招募机制模型.
- 这一发现揭示了SF3B1,SUGP1和DHX15在保持拼接保真性方面的作用.
- 该模型提供了有关癌症相关拼接缺陷的见解.

RNA editing is a post-transcriptional modification where a precursor mRNA (pre-mRNA) nucleotide sequence is changed by base insertion, deletion, or modification. The extent of RNA editing varies from a few hundred bases, in mitochondrial DNA of trypanosomes, to a just single base, in nuclear genes of mammals. Alternative RNA splicing is the regulated splicing of exons and introns to produce different mature mRNAs from a single pre-mRNA. Unlike in constitutive splicing where a single gene produces a single type of mRNA, alternative splicing allows an organism to produce multiple proteins from a single gene and plays an important role in protein diversity.

Base complementarity between the three base pairs of mRNA codon and the tRNA anticodon is not a failsafe mechanism. Inaccuracies can range from a single mismatch to no correct base pairing at all. The free energy difference between the correct and nearly correct base pairs can be as small as 3 kcal/ mol.
